Ingredients
- 2 packages (8 oz each) refrigerated crescent roll dough
- 8 slices thinly sliced deli roast beef
- 8 slices thinly sliced deli turkey
- 8 slices cheese (Swiss, provolone, or mild cheddar)
- 2 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
Instructions
- Preheat the air fryer to 325°F (160°C).
- Unroll crescent roll dough into triangles.
- Layer cheese, turkey, and roast beef on each triangle.
- Roll from the wide end to form croissants; tuck tips underneath to seal.
- Brush tops with melted butter and add optional toppings (sesame seeds/herbs).
- Arrange croissants in the air fryer basket, ensuring space between them.
- Air fry for about 6 minutes; flip and cook for another 4-6 minutes until golden brown.
- Let rest for a few minutes before serving.
- Prep Time: 20 minutes
- Cook Time: 12 minutes
